The Sheer Impact of a Truck Accident
Truck accidents are fundamentally different from ordinary collisions in ways that most people don’t fully comprehend until they experience one. An 80,000-pound vehicle traveling at highway speed carries enormous destructive power that can turn even minor miscalculations into catastrophic disasters affecting multiple vehicles and families.
Even a small error like drifting out of a lane, braking too late, or misjudging stopping distance can cause devastating multi-vehicle pileups that destroy lives in seconds. Victims frequently suffer spinal cord damage, traumatic brain injuries, crushed limbs, or multiple fractures that require extensive surgical intervention and rehabilitation lasting months or years.
The sheer force of impact means that passenger cars are often crushed beyond recognition, leaving little protection for drivers and passengers inside. Beyond the immediate physical damage, victims also face skyrocketing medical expenses that can easily reach hundreds of thousands of dollars and recovery timelines that stretch far longer than anyone anticipates.
For many people, this means extended time away from work, permanent changes in physical capabilities, and a complete transformation of their lifestyle and future plans. These harsh realities highlight how quickly life can change because of one driver’s momentary lapse in judgment.
The Emotional Toll on Victims and Families
While physical injuries are visible and measurable, the emotional wounds of a truck accident often run much deeper and last much longer than anyone expects. Survivors frequently develop post-traumatic stress disorder, experience recurring nightmares, or develop an intense fear of driving or even being a passenger that can persist for years.
Family members suddenly thrust into caregiver roles may live with constant worry about their loved one’s future while struggling with the overwhelming stress of managing medical care, insurance claims, and financial pressures. Everyday tasks that were once simple become monumental challenges, and relationships may suffer under the enormous weight of recovery and adaptation.
Children who witness or are involved in truck accidents often carry that trauma throughout their development, affecting their sense of safety and trust in the world around them. The emotional impact extends to grandparents, siblings, and close friends who watch their loved ones struggle with pain and limitation.
Financial uncertainty caused by lost wages, reduced earning capacity, and mounting medical bills adds another crushing layer of emotional strain that can destroy family stability. This emotional toll is every bit as real and significant as physical injuries, often shaping a victim’s quality of life and relationships long after physical healing occurs.
